Re: Stop Leak

Oil stop leak products are for engines w/synthetic material seals, like neoprene for example. With age and heat the seals tend to stiffen up, lessening there ability to seal against the moving...

Re: E-brake Backing Plate Welding

The toggle lever shaft housing was loose on one side of my A. I just squared it up and gave it a couple of good tack welds, it's been good for a number of years.
